avoparvekkeet
Avoparvekkeet are a type of balcony found in Finnish architecture. The term derives from avo, meaning open, and parveke, meaning balcony, and refers to outdoor spaces that are not fully enclosed by glass or other interior walls. Avoparvekkeet extend from a building’s façade and are typically bounded by railings or parapets, making them exposed to the external environment.
